Abstract
A Ba0.5(Bi0.5K0.5)0.5TiO3 (BBKT) plate-like particle is synthesized by a novel two-step solvothermal soft chemical process. In the first step plate-like particles of a layered titanate H1.07Ti1.73O4 (HTO) precursor is solvothermally treated in Ba(OH)2 solution to obtain plate-like particles of a BaTiO3-HTO (BT-HTO) nanocomposite. In the second step the nanocomposite particles are hydrothermally treated in BiCl3-KOH solution to obtain the BBKT plate-like particles.
